Cameroon: Outspoken Critic of Cameroon President Excluded From October Election

[AllAfrica - Africa] - 28/07/2025
[RFI] Maurice Kamto, a high-profile critic of Cameroon's long-running President Paul Biya has been excluded by electoral authorities from the list of approved candidates able to run in the 12 October presidential vote.
